
The ocean waves are the eternal whispers of an unbreakable love.
—What lingers after this line?
Symbolism of Ocean Waves
The ocean waves symbolize continuity and permanence. They represent the constant and enduring nature of true love, which, like the waves, never ceases to exist.
Eternal Connection
This quote highlights the idea of an eternal and unbreakable bond. Just as the ocean waves are endless, true love is depicted as everlasting and unwavering.
Whispers of Love
The term 'whispers' suggests a gentle, yet intimate communication. It emphasizes the subtle and profound ways in which love manifests itself, consistently present even if not always overtly visible.
Romantic Imagery
Using the imagery of the ocean, the quote invokes a sense of beauty and magnificence associated with love. The natural tranquility and vastness of the ocean parallel the depth and serenity of an unbreakable romantic bond.
Nature as a Metaphor
Comparing love to the ocean ties human emotions to the natural world. It reflects the belief that love, like nature, is a fundamental and elemental force, shaping and sustaining life.
